Why Clean Your Beverage Fridge?

Keeping your beverage fridge clean isn't just about appearances. Over time, spills, stains, and food particles can build up, leading to funky smells and even mold. Regular cleaning keeps your drinks fresh and safe to consume. Plus, a clean fridge runs smoother, saving you on energy bills and extending the life of your appliance.

Perks of a Clean Beverage Fridge

A spotless beverage fridge comes with a bunch of benefits:

  • Better Hygiene: Regular cleaning zaps bacteria, mold, and mildew, ensuring your drinks stay in a sanitary spot.
  • Boosted Efficiency: A clean fridge runs like a well-oiled machine, free from dust and grime that can mess with airflow and cooling.
  • Odor Control: Cleaning gets rid of nasty smells from spills and spoiled drinks, keeping your fridge smelling fresh.
  • Longer Lifespan: Regular maintenance can make your beverage fridge last longer, cutting down on costly repairs or replacements.

Getting Ready to Clean

Preparation is key for a smooth cleaning process. Gather your supplies and follow some safety steps to make the job easier and safer.

What You’ll Need

Before diving in, grab these items:

  • Microfiber cloths or soft rags
  • Mild dish soap or a gentle cleaner
  • Baking soda (for tough stains)
  • Warm water
  • A bucket or basin
  • A sponge or soft brush
  • Paper towels
  • White vinegar (optional for deodorizing)
  • Rubber gloves

These tools will help you tackle every part of the fridge, from shelves to the interior and exterior.

Safety First

Safety matters when cleaning any appliance. Here’s how to stay safe:

  1. Unplug the Fridge: Always unplug before cleaning to avoid electric shocks.
  2. Handle with Care: Be gentle when removing shelves or racks to avoid breakage or injury.
  3. Ventilation: Make sure the area is well-ventilated, especially if using cleaning agents with fumes.
  4. Wear Gloves: Protect your hands from harsh cleaners and prevent skin irritation.
  5. Avoid Abrasive Cleaners: Skip the abrasive stuff to avoid damaging the fridge surfaces.

Cleaning the Inside

Cleaning the inside of your beverage fridge is crucial for keeping your drinks fresh and your fridge running efficiently. Here’s how to do it:

Empty and Defrost

Start by emptying the fridge and defrosting if needed. Remove all beverages and any removable shelves or racks.

  1. Unplug the Fridge: Make sure it’s unplugged to avoid electrical hazards.
  2. Remove All Items: Take out all cans, bottles, and food items.
  3. Defrost if Needed: If there’s ice buildup, let it defrost completely. Use towels to catch any melting ice.

Clean Shelves and Racks

Next, clean the shelves and racks.

  1. Remove Shelves and Racks: Take out all removable parts.
  2. Wash with Soapy Water: Use warm, soapy water to clean them. A sponge or soft brush works well for scrubbing.
  3. Rinse and Dry: Rinse thoroughly with clean water and dry with a towel or let them air dry.

Wipe Interior Surfaces

Now, focus on the interior surfaces.

  1. Mix a Cleaning Solution: Combine equal parts water and vinegar in a spray bottle. This natural solution disinfects and deodorizes.
  2. Spray and Wipe: Spray the solution on the interior walls, floor, and ceiling. Wipe down all surfaces with a clean cloth or sponge, paying special attention to corners and crevices.
  3. Rinse and Dry: Use a damp cloth to wipe away any residue. Dry the interior thoroughly with a clean towel.

Cleaning the Outside

Keeping the outside of your beverage fridge clean is just as important. Here’s how to do it:

Dust and Grime Removal

Start by unplugging your fridge for safety. Use a soft, dry cloth or a vacuum with a brush attachment to remove dust from the exterior surfaces. Focus on the vents and coils, as dust here can affect efficiency.

For greasy or sticky spots, dampen a cloth with a mild detergent solution and gently wipe the surfaces. Avoid abrasive cleaners or scrubbers to prevent scratches.

Clean Door Seals

Door seals are crucial for keeping the cold air in. Over time, dirt and grime can mess with their effectiveness.

To clean the seals, mix equal parts water and vinegar. Use a soft cloth or toothbrush to gently scrub the seals, getting into all the crevices. Wipe away any residue with a damp cloth and dry thoroughly to prevent mold.

Polish Stainless Steel

If your fridge has a stainless steel exterior, polishing it keeps it looking sharp. Use a stainless steel cleaner or a mix of water and mild dish soap. Apply with a soft cloth, wiping in the direction of the grain to avoid streaks.

Deodorizing and Maintenance

Keeping your beverage fridge clean helps prevent odors and mold. Here’s how to deodorize and maintain it:

Banishing Odors

Beverage fridges can develop unpleasant smells over time. Here’s how to keep it fresh:

  2. Natural Deodorizers: Place an open box of baking soda or activated charcoal inside to absorb odors.
  3. Vinegar Solution: Wipe down interior surfaces with a mix of equal parts water and white vinegar to neutralize odors.

Preventing Mold and Mildew

To keep mold and mildew at bay, follow these tips:

  1. Ensure Airflow: Make sure there’s enough space around your fridge for proper ventilation.
  2. Keep It Dry: Wipe spills immediately and ensure the interior is dry after cleaning.
  3. Check Door Seals: Keep door seals clean and intact to prevent moisture buildup.

Putting It All Back Together

Drying and Reassembling

After cleaning, make sure everything is completely dry to avoid mold. Use a clean, dry cloth to wipe down all surfaces, and let shelves and racks air dry if needed.

Reassemble your fridge by placing shelves and racks back in their spots. Make sure they’re secure to avoid any wobbles when restocking.

Restocking and Organizing

Once your fridge is dry and reassembled, it’s time to restock and organize your drinks. Wipe down each bottle or can to ensure no residue or dust gets back into the clean fridge.

Organize your beverages by type, size, or how often you use them. Put frequently used items at eye level and less-used items on lower shelves. This keeps things tidy and makes it easier to find what you need.
